Out this week: Sins of the Salton Sea #1 (AWA, $3.99):
Ed Brisson and C. P. Smith present the story of a thief going after “one last job��� who ends up caught between a doomsday cult and the young boy the plan to sacrifice to save the world.

SINS OF THE SALTON SEA #1 (of 5) Written by Ed Brisson Illustrated by C.P. Smith Cover by Tim Bradstreet Variant Cover by Mike Deodato Jr. & Lee Loughridge Saul Bass Homage Cover by Chris Ferguson & C.P. Smith 1:15 B&W Incentive Cover by Mike Deodato Jr. Crime Noir and supernatural horror collide in this gritty heist-gone-wrong thriller by Ed Brisson (Old Man Logan) and C.P. Smith (Wolverine). ON SALE- JUNE 7 $3.99 MATURE READERS 32 PAGES https://www.instagram.com/p/CqB26Kupz6l/?igshid=NGJjMDIxMWI=

AWA Studios has announced Sins of the Salton Sea, a five-issue series debuting on June 7, 2023. From the all-star creative team of writer Ed Brisson, artist C.P. Smith, and lettered by Hassan Otsmane-Elhaou, this new…AWA announces Sins of the Salton Sea from Ed Brisson and C.P. Smith

Preview: Sins of the Salton Sea #2 (of 5)
Sins of the Salton Sea #2 preview. Captured by The Sons of the Salton Sea, Jasper comes face to face with the group's leader, while Wyatt tries to evade the cult and the local police that work for them #comics #comicbooks

The Resistance: Uprising #1 (AWA, $3.99): J. Michael Straczynski and C.P. Smith kick off the next chapter of The Resistance this week, continuing the story from the first miniseries after the assassination of their leader.
